Job Description

**POSITION SUMMARY:** Responsible for submitting all credentialing and re-credentialing applications and attachments for all services and facilities within PruittHealth. **WORKING RELATIONSHIPS:** Directly Reports to: Director of Managed Care Contracts **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S, DUTIES, AND RESPONSIBILITIES:** - Review and process incoming and outgoing paperwork, including directory updates, provider credentialing applications, demographic changes of services and other related forms. - Provide office, project management and data analysis support. - Maintain a comprehensive database of all facilities and payers with updated information regarding credentialing and re-credentialing - Maintain a file with updated copies of all documents required for credentialing of all PruittHealth services. - Answers incoming telephone inquiries from PruittHealth entities and payers regarding contracts and credentialing issues. - Work closely with all PruittHealth entities and educate on the requirements of credentialing and re-credentialing. - Support the Payer Relations with reports and updates regarding participation status with all payers. - Maintain corporate standard time frame for completion of credentialing applications. - Perform special projects upon request - Excellent Communication, Customer Service and Time Management Skills - Handles any additional duties as assigned by Management **ESSENTIAL SKILLS AND COMPETENCY:** - Ability to multi-task and handle consistent workflow - Ability to think critically and work independently - Attendance - must maintain timely, regular attendance. - Communicates well with clients, vendors, fellow partners, visitors and family members providing warm and friendly greeting and an approachable attitude. Answers questions when appropriate in a professional manner. - Develop and foster relationships - Effective oral, written and telephone skills - Excellent customer service and communication skills - Initiative to follow-up on pending issues and organize and assign work - Must be able to maintain confidentiality regarding company proprietary information - Must have the ability to relate professionally and positively and work cooperatively with external partners and other employees at all levels - Professional appearance. Dresses according to Company's Dress Code Policy - Proficiency in MS Office Suite (Excel, PowerPoint, Word, Outlook, Teams, etc.) - Work within scope of job requirements **ESSENTIAL ADMINISTRATIVE FUNCTIONS:** - Attends and participates in continuing educational programs to keep abreast of changes in your field as well as to maintain current license/certification as required. - Attends and participates in mandatory in-services. - Complies with corporate compliance program. - Performs other related duties as necessary and as directed by supervisor. **PREFERR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E:** - Minimum 2 years' experience in healthcare contract credentialing or equivalent **Family Makes Us Stronger.** Our family, your family, one family.
